    EXYNOS5250: be less chatty at critical moments
    
    The 5250 DRAM code is *really* chatty. That's not a great
    idea in time critical code, and DRAM init is generally
    very sensitive about such things.
    
    Finally, for those things that are errors, print them
    at an error level, not a debug level.
